Waste Management, Oakland’s trash hauler, has agreed to pay $7.9 million to settle a lawsuit the city filed during last year’s garbage lockout, according to the Oakland Tribune and the San Francisco Chronicle. The deal marked another victory for Mayor Ron Dellums, following a string of recent accomplishments. Last week, the City Council unanimously approved his plan for beefing up the city’s police department and agreed to protect most of the city’s industrial land as he requested. Last summer, the mayor brokered an end to the nasty garbage lockout in what was widely viewed as his first major accomplishment since taking office in January 2007.
